Vintage sound chips make cool music, but what's hiding inside of them? Which algorithms are they using?
In the past years I've been dedicating my free time to building emulators for old digital sound chips from synthesizers/game consoles, in an effort to preserve them and make them usable without the original hardware. During this time I went through lots of interesting stuff: silicon reverse engineering, logic analyzers, weird compression schemes, forgotten audio algorithms and more. In this talk I want to share with you what I learned from this process and what's next. Specifically, I will explain how I'm currently reverse engineering a custom DSP from the 90s just by using an Arduino Mega and lots of speculation, and how you can probably apply the same process to other chips as well.
